
엑셀에서 업무를 처리하다 보면 셀에 포함된 수식의 결과를 코멘트로 표시하여 데이터의 의미를 명확히 하고 싶은 경우가 종종 있습니다. 기본적으로 엑셀은 수식 결과를 자동으로 코멘트에 삽입하는 내장 기능을 제공하지 않지만, 몇 가지 창의적인 방법을 통해 이 문제를 효과적으로 해결할 수 있습니다. 이러한 기능을 활용하면 복잡한 스프레드시트에서 데이터의 맥락을 더 쉽게 이해할 수 있고, 팀원들과의 협업 시 정보 전달이 훨씬 명확해집니다.
VBA 코드를 활용한 자동화 방법
VBA를 사용하면 선택한 셀 범위의 수식 결과를 자동으로 코멘트에 삽입할 수 있습니다. 이 방법은 프로그래밍 지식이 조금 필요하지만 한 번 설정하면 반복적인 작업을 크게 줄일 수 있습니다. Alt + F11 키를 눌러 Visual Basic Editor를 열고, 새로운 모듈에 전용 코드를 삽입합니다. 이 코드는 활성 시트에서 수식이 포함된 셀을 자동으로 감지하고, 각 셀의 계산 결과를 해당 셀의 코멘트로 추가합니다. 특히 대량의 데이터를 처리할 때 매우 효율적이며, 실행 시간도 빠른 편입니다. 마이크로소프트 엑셀 공식 지원 페이지에서 VBA 관련 추가 정보를 확인할 수 있습니다.
Kutools for Excel 확장 프로그램 활용법
Kutools for Excel은 엑셀의 기능을 대폭 확장시켜주는 서드파티 도구로, 코멘트와 셀 간의 변환 기능을 통해 수식 결과를 쉽게 코멘트에 삽입할 수 있습니다. 이 도구를 사용하면 복잡한 코딩 없이도 몇 번의 클릭만으로 원하는 결과를 얻을 수 있습니다. 설치 후 Kutools 메뉴에서 코멘트와 셀 간의 변환 옵션을 선택하고, 셀 내용을 코멘트에 추가 기능을 활용하면 됩니다. 이 방법은 특히 엑셀 초보자나 VBA에 익숙하지 않은 사용자들에게 매우 유용합니다.
- 설치가 간단하고 사용자 친화적인 인터페이스 제공
- 300개 이상의 다양한 엑셀 확장 기능을 한 번에 이용 가능
- 30일간 모든 기능을 무료로 체험할 수 있어 부담 없이 시작 가능
- 대량 데이터 처리 시에도 안정적인 성능을 보여줌
수동 방법과 각 접근법의 장단점 비교
수식 결과를 코멘트에 삽입하는 다양한 방법들을 비교해보면 각각의 특징과 적합한 사용 상황을 파악할 수 있습니다. 수동 방법은 가장 기본적이지만 시간이 많이 소요되고, VBA 방법은 자동화가 가능하지만 코딩 지식이 필요합니다.
| 방법 | 장점 | 단점 |
|---|---|---|
| 수동 입력 | 추가 도구 설치 불필요, 완전한 제어 가능 | 시간 소모적, 오타 발생 가능성 |
| VBA 스크립트 | 완전 자동화, 대량 처리 가능 | 코딩 지식 필요, 보안 설정 조정 |
| Kutools 확장 | 사용 편의성, 다양한 추가 기능 | 유료 소프트웨어, 외부 의존성 |
| 수식 연동 | 실시간 업데이트, 동적 변경 | 복잡한 설정, 성능 영향 가능 |
실무 적용 시 고려사항과 팁
수식 결과를 코멘트에 삽입할 때는 몇 가지 중요한 사항을 고려해야 합니다. 먼저 코멘트가 너무 많으면 엑셀 파일의 크기가 커지고 성능이 저하될 수 있으므로, 정말 필요한 부분에만 선별적으로 적용하는 것이 좋습니다. 또한 수식이 변경되면 코멘트도 함께 업데이트해야 하므로, 정기적인 동기화 작업이 필요합니다. 엑셀 실무 가이드에서 관련 팁을 더 자세히 확인할 수 있습니다.
특히 팀 단위로 작업할 때는 코멘트 표시 형식을 통일하고, 어떤 정보를 코멘트로 표시할지에 대한 명확한 가이드라인을 수립하는 것이 중요합니다. 이렇게 하면 문서의 일관성을 유지하고 다른 팀원들이 쉽게 이해할 수 있습니다.
고급 활용 방법과 자동화 전략
더 나아가 조건부 서식과 연계하여 특정 조건을 만족하는 셀에만 자동으로 코멘트를 생성하는 방법도 있습니다. 예를 들어, 매출 목표 달성률이 100% 이상인 셀에만 코멘트를 추가하거나, 오차율이 일정 수준을 벗어나는 데이터에 경고 메시지를 코멘트로 표시할 수 있습니다. 이러한 고급 기능을 활용하면 데이터 분석의 효율성을 크게 향상시킬 수 있습니다. 스프레드시트 전문가 가이드에서 더 많은 활용법을 찾아볼 수 있습니다.
또한 매크로를 이용하여 정기적으로 실행되는 자동화 시스템을 구축할 수도 있습니다. 예를 들어, 매주 월요일마다 자동으로 실행되어 주간 보고서의 모든 수식 결과를 코멘트로 업데이트하는 시스템을 만들 수 있습니다. 이렇게 하면 수동 작업을 최소화하고 항상 최신 정보를 유지할 수 있습니다.
문제 해결 및 성능 최적화 방법
수식 결과를 코멘트에 삽입하는 과정에서 발생할 수 있는 일반적인 문제들과 해결 방법을 알아두는 것이 중요합니다. 가장 흔한 문제는 수식이 오류를 반환할 때 코멘트에도 오류 메시지가 표시되는 것입니다. 이를 방지하기 위해서는 IFERROR 함수를 활용하여 오류 발생 시 대체 텍스트를 표시하도록 설정할 수 있습니다. 또한 순환 참조나 외부 링크가 포함된 수식의 경우 코멘트 생성 시 예상치 못한 결과가 나올 수 있으므로 사전에 수식을 점검하는 것이 필요합니다.
성능 최적화 측면에서는 너무 많은 코멘트가 한 번에 생성되지 않도록 배치 처리를 하거나, 화면 업데이트를 일시적으로 비활성화하는 Application.ScreenUpdating = False 명령어를 활용하는 것이 도움이 됩니다. 엑셀젯 성능 최적화 가이드에서 더 자세한 최적화 방법을 확인할 수 있습니다.



